At 1000 CDT power and internet went out at the same moment. I looked out the window and two 70' tall Southern Pines that were by the drive in the next door neighbor's yard, being blown by the east wind bending nearly a third of the way to the ground from 90+ mph winds. I was not aware that hurricane Michael had made landfall between 0800 and 0900 at Mexico Beach, which is south of where I live and came straight into Panama City, Florida headed north.

I went to the front door and opened it cautiously. Barely able to stand, there were no trees down as yet, and looking around I was at awe what I was seeing. Went to the back door and there was one oak tree down, 20' from the house but fell to the west. About that time the top 25' of a pine from the east neighbor's yard landed in the back yard.

Went back to my room and prayed for protection for my friends that I live with and myself. None of us were injured. Nor were their two dogs and two cats. Scared to death, yeah, hiding.

As I was sitting at my desk, the two pines I previously mentioned began their plummet to the ground, directly across the driveway. Before I could get up two more pines on the east end of the house fell on the east end of the house, a broken branch coming through the ceiling allowing water and insulation to come in, but not over my bed, destroying the bedroom on the end.

I had lost all track of time. Several trees were down in the back yard and the winds began to die down. A short time later, it was calm and we walked out on the porch and could see blue sky and realized we were in the Eye of the hurricane. Pretty soon the winds began to pick up and the back side of Michael began to hit. Now the winds were coming from the west, and praise Yahweh, there were no trees on the west end.

After it was all over we still had cell phone service and I called several friends in other states and was told by them that Panama City and the track of the eye up highway 231 had sustained winds of 152 mph. But we lived through the eye of hurricane Michael and survived.
